#045e59 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#045e59 is composed of 1.6% red, 36.9%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.3% yellow and 63.1% black. It has a hue angle of 176.7 degrees, a saturation of 91.8% and a lightness of 19.2%. #045e59 color hex could be obtained by blending #08bcb2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#045e59 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#045e59 has RGB values of R:4, G:94,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0, Y:0.05, K:0.63. Its decimal value is 286297.
